Analysis

The most recent figure for nutrient nitrogen n (total) — export quantity, gaps filled in India is 57,959 t, measured in 2024.

Compared with earlier readings it is up 5.1% on the previous year and up 143.8% over ten years.

Over the whole period, nutrient nitrogen n (total) — export quantity, gaps filled in India peaked at 91,673 t in 2018 and was at its lowest, 329 t, in 1990.

India ranks 60th of 216 countries on this measure, in the middle of the range.

The series is highly variable year to year, so single readings are best treated with caution.

How this figure is calculated

Nutrient nitrogen N (total) — Export quantity with 86 missing years estimated by linear interpolation between the nearest real observations. Only gaps of 4 years or fewer are filled, and never beyond the first or last actual measurement — these are filled holes, not forecasts.
